p-Nitrophenol Sodium Salt (CAS No. 824-78-2) is a high-purity organic compound with the molecular formula C6H4NNaO3 and IUPAC name sodium;4-nitrophenolate. This yellow crystalline powder is widely utilized in biochemical and chemical research due to its role as a chromogenic substrate for enzyme assays, particularly alkaline phosphatase. It exhibits excellent solubility in water and polar organic solvents, making it ideal for laboratory applications. Our product is rigorously tested for purity (>98%) and consistency, ensuring reliable performance in sensitive experiments. Suitable for spectrophotometric analysis, it is packaged under controlled conditions to maintain stability and shelf life. Synonyms include Sodium 4-nitrophenolate, Sodium p-nitrophenoxide, and 4-Nitrophenol sodium salt.

Application
p-Nitrophenol Sodium Salt is commonly used as a substrate for alkaline phosphatase in enzymatic assays, where its hydrolysis produces a yellow-colored product measurable at 405 nm. It serves as a key reagent in biochemical research for studying enzyme kinetics and inhibition. Additionally, it finds applications in organic synthesis as an intermediate for dyes, pharmaceuticals, and agrochemicals. Its stability and water solubility make it suitable for buffer-based assays and diagnostic applications.
Safety and Hazards
GHS Hazard Statements
- H302: Harmful if swallowed [Warning Acute toxicity, oral]
- H371: May cause damage to organs [Warning Specific target organ toxicity, single exposure]
- H373: May causes damage to organs through prolonged or repeated exposure [Warning Specific target organ toxicity, repeated exposure]
